windshield wiper polarity 90 ranger
i just put in a new wiper motor in a 90 ford ranger. i checked it before installing it by plugging in the plug and touching the case to ground to make sure it worked as the removal was tough. the motor worked fine so i was ready to install and noticed this warning not to do what i just did or the polarity would be reversed. after installing it, the wipers stop in the vertical position, not horizontal. reinstalling the blades do not solve the problem as they want to go down onto the hood. Do i just reinstall with the motor crank 180 off or do i have to do something to reverse the polarity? i am not really sure if the polarity has anything at all to do with the vertical park position. thanks for your help
